Creamy Carbonara<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>A classic dish that feels special but takes only 15 minutes to make.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Carbonara is one of those meals that looks impressive yet is unbelievably simple. It\u2019s warm, filling, and perfect for those evenings when everyone\u2019s hungry <em>now<\/em>.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Why it\u2019s great for dads: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Minimal ingredients<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Ready fast<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Kids love pasta<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>How it works:<\/strong><br>Cook pasta, fry some bacon or pancetta, mix eggs with grated cheese, then toss everything together while it\u2019s still hot. The heat from the pasta creates that silky sauce \u2014 no cream needed. Serve immediately for a cosy, comforting bowl.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">\ud83c\udf4d 2. Sweet and Sour Chicken With Rice<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>A colourful, tasty dish that feels like a takeaway treat but is healthier and far cheaper.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>This meal is brilliant because you can add whatever vegetables you have lying around \u2014 peppers, onions, carrots, even pineapple chunks.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Why it\u2019s great for dads: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Easy to sneak in vegetables<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Flexible ingredients<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Kids enjoy the sweet flavour<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>How it works:<\/strong><br>Fry chicken pieces until golden, add chopped veg, pour over sweet-and-sour sauce, then simmer while you cook your rice. Serve with a good scoop of fluffy rice and you\u2019ve got a bright, delicious dish that tastes like a family favourite.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">\ud83c\udf55 3. Homemade Pizza With Chips and Veg<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Fun, interactive, and guaranteed to get kids excited for dinner.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Homemade pizza is one of the easiest ways to make mealtimes more enjoyable. Kids love choosing their own toppings, and you can keep it simple with wraps, pitta breads or flatbreads as the base.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Why it\u2019s great for dads: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Completely customisable<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Quick prep and quick cooking<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Perfect for getting kids involved<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>How it works:<\/strong><br>Spread tomato sauce on your chosen base, sprinkle cheese, add toppings (ham, sweetcorn, mushrooms, peppers \u2014 whatever they enjoy), and bake for 8\u201310 minutes. Serve with oven chips and a side of veg for a balanced, fun meal.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">\ud83e\udd58 4. One-Pan Sausage and Veg Traybake<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>This is the ultimate \u201cdad meal\u201d \u2014 throw everything on a tray and let the oven do the work.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Traybakes are lifesavers on busy evenings. There\u2019s almost no prep, barely any washing up, and the flavour is always fantastic.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Why it\u2019s great for dads: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Zero fuss<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>One tray = minimal cleanup<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Works with whatever veg you have<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>How it works:<\/strong><br>Place sausages, potatoes, peppers, onions, and carrots on a baking tray. Drizzle with oil, sprinkle herbs or seasoning, then roast until everything is golden. It\u2019s hearty, simple and incredibly reliable.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">\ud83c\udf2f 5. Chicken Wraps With Salad and Cheese<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Fresh, quick and easy \u2014 perfect for lighter evenings or when you want something fuss-free.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Wraps are a brilliant option for dads because the kids can build their own. It becomes half meal, half activity, and that alone helps encourage them to eat.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Why it\u2019s great for dads: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Fast to prepare<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Customisable<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Great for picky eaters<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>How it works:<\/strong><br>Cook chicken strips, warm the wraps, and lay out salad, cheese and any extras. Let the kids assemble their own \u2014 they\u2019ll love the independence and creativity.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">\ud83c\udf7d\ufe0f Simple meals can mean the most<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>You don\u2019t need complicated recipes or long prep times to cook well for your kids.
